Web15 sep. 2024 · There are currently 135 Swiss Guards, most of whom sleep in communal barracks, while the married ones live with their families in separate apartments outside the Vatican. The new facilities, promise to bring "more space, single rooms, apartments for the families, better quality of the building (humidity, heating) and eco-friendly construction," … WebThe Pontifical Swiss Guard forms a company with the rank of regiment, whose effective personnel - composed of 135 elements - is fixed as follows: COMMISSIONED OFFICERS 1 Commander with the rank of Colonel; 1 Vice-Commander with the rank of Lieutenant Colonel; 1 Chaplain equal in rank to Lieutenant Colonel; 1 Major; 2 Captains; 3 Lieutenants.

Two different units of Swiss mercenaries performed guard duties for the Kings of France: the Hundred Swiss (Cent Suisses) served in the Palace essentially as bodyguards and ceremonial troops, and the Swiss Guards (Gardes Suisses), who guarded entrances and outer perimeter. In addition, the Gardes Suisses served in the field as a fighting regiment in times of war.
